BizDojo Friends Launch Futuristic Lighting System on KickStarter
BizDojo partner company MEA Mobile has launched a KickStarter campaign for their "iGloLED" – a smartphone controllable strip of LED lights.
iGloLED is a strip of coloured LED lights that you control with an iPhone or Android control app. You can interact with the lights in real time, program and save patterns, individually address each LED in the strip, select from a full colour palette and create dynamic effects.

MEA Mobile Launches Mobile Printing App with Major US Retailer
MEA Mobile has launched an app called Printicular in the USA. Printicular is a partnership with Walgreens, one of America's biggest pharmacy chains.
In a world first, Printicular allows you to send your photos directly from your phone to the local Walgreens. They print them out for pick-up in just one hour.
Print sizes include Instagram’s popular and funky 4x4 format, as well as 4x6, 5x7 and 8x10 options for regular Camera Roll / Gallery photos.

MEA Mobile to Launch New Zealand’s First App School
In response to the dire shortage of skilled mobile app developers, MEA Mobile and Prima Learning are collaborating to put together New Zealand’s first ever App School.
MEA Mobile is owned by MacFarlane Engel Associates, a partner company to The BizDojo.
App School is a 9 week full-time course to learn the newest in-demand programming language, along with professional tricks and tips. Currently, the course covers the key skills required to create apps for iOS. Future courses will cover Android and other mobile platforms.
During the course, programmers get to learn from experienced professionals, create commercial apps, and interact with potential employers. The intense 9 weeks comprise morning lectures, demonstrations, and tutorials, which will be followed by hands-on, mentored project sessions in the afternoons. Experienced programmers will get the chance to explore topics in more depth independently during these sessions.
